Lime & chilli kumara chips

Lime & chilli kumara chips are a delicious and healthy alternative to conventional potato chips. Made from sweet potatoes, these chips are seasoned with a zesty lime and a kick of chili powder, creating a perfect balance of flavors that will tantalize your taste buds. Ingredients:

2 sweet potatos
400g
1 tsp salt
5g
1 tbsp lime zest
16g
1 tsp chili powder
5g

Instructions:

1. Preheat the Oven:
Preheat your oven to 200°C (400°F).
2. Prepare the Sweet Potatoes:
Peel the sweet potatoes and cut them into thin, even slices or your preferred chip shape.
3. Season the Sweet Potatoes:
In a large mixing bowl, combine the sweet potato slices, salt, lime zest, and chili powder. Toss everything together until the sweet potato slices are evenly coated with the seasoning mixture.
4. Arrange on Baking Sheet:
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or lightly grease it. Spread the seasoned sweet potato slices out in a single layer on the baking sheet, ensuring they are not overlapping. This helps them cook evenly and get crispy.
5. Bake:
Place the baking sheet in the preheated oven and bake for about 20-25 minutes. Halfway through the baking time (around the 10-12 minute mark), flip the sweet potato slices to ensure they cook evenly on both sides.
6. Check for Crispiness:
Keep an eye on the sweet potatoes during the last few minutes of baking to ensure they don't burn. They should be golden brown and crispy around the edges.
7. Cool and Serve:
Once done, remove the sweet potato chips from the oven and allow them to cool for a few minutes on the baking sheet. This will help them crisp up further.
8. Enjoy:
Serve the lime & chilli kumara chips as a tasty snack or side dish. They can be enjoyed on their own or paired with your favorite dip.

Tips:

- Ensure your sweet potatoes are sliced evenly to promote uniform cooking.

- For extra crispiness, soak the sliced sweet potatoes in cold water for 1-2 hours before baking. Pat them dry thoroughly before seasoning.

- Experiment with the level of chili powder to suit your taste preferences. You can always add more if you like extra heat.

- Try using a baking rack to elevate the chips in the oven for even cooking and maximum crispiness.

- Serve the chips with a dip such as guacamole or a tangy yogurt-based sauce to enhance the flavor profile.
